Compartilhar via


TemplatedModelGenerator Classe

Definição

Tipo base para geradores de código de modelo que usam modelos.

public abstract class TemplatedModelGenerator : Microsoft.EntityFrameworkCore.Scaffolding.ModelCodeGenerator
type TemplatedModelGenerator = class
    inherit ModelCodeGenerator
Public MustInherit Class TemplatedModelGenerator
Inherits ModelCodeGenerator
Herança
TemplatedModelGenerator

Construtores

TemplatedModelGenerator(ModelCodeGeneratorDependencies)

Inicializa uma nova instância da classe TemplatedModelGenerator.

Propriedades

Dependencies

Dependências para esse serviço.

(Herdado de ModelCodeGenerator)
Language

Obtém a linguagem de programação compatível com esse serviço.

TemplatesDirectory

Obtém o subdiretório no projeto no qual procurar modelos.

Métodos

GenerateModel(IModel, ModelCodeGenerationOptions)

Gera código para um modelo.

(Herdado de ModelCodeGenerator)
GenerateModel(IModel, String, String, String, String, ModelCodeGenerationOptions)

Gera código para um modelo.

(Herdado de ModelCodeGenerator)
HasTemplates(String)

Verifica se os modelos necessários para esse gerador estão presentes.

Aplica-se a